The correct choice is Option 1: 'Yes, sounds good. Let's go.' When invited with '〜ませんか' (Would you like to...?), a cheerful agreement is formulated as 'ええ、いいですね。行きましょう' (Oh, that sounds great. Let's go). Option 2 ('いいえ、見に行きます' - No, I will go watch) is grammatically conflicting. Option 3 uses the past tense for a future invitation, which is incorrect.
